cgroup: drop CGRP_ROOT_SUBSYS_BOUND
Before kernfs conversion, due to the way super_block lookup works, cgroup roots were created and made visible before being fully initialized. This in turn required a special flag to mark that the root hasn't been fully initialized so that the destruction path can tell fully bound ones from half initialized. That flag is CGRP_ROOT_SUBSYS_BOUND and no longer necessary after the kernfs conversion as the lookup and creation of new root are atomic w.r.t. cgroup_mutex. This patch removes the flag and passes the requests subsystem mask to cgroup_setup_root() so that it can set the respective mask bits as subsystems are bound.
